Adding Integers! Using the Chip model

What is an Integer?  A whole number (so not a fraction)  Can be positive or negative  Includes zero Examples: 0, 1, -5, -223, 40,876

Zero Pairs  A pair of numbers who sum (addition) is zero  In the video we saw that a negative and positive cancelled each other out or battled—We call that finding zero pairs!

Chip Model Represent the problem with integer chips. Now find zero pairs! We have one positive chip left so our answer is… +

Try this one - + Represent the problem with integer chips Find the zero pairs! We have two negative chips left so… - -

More practice: - + Represent the problem with integer chips Do we have zero pairs? Nope! Since negatives are on the same team they don’t battle! So we just add all the chips of the same color (sign) together!
